On Saturday, April 12, former Shenango High School standout Anthony Ryan’s current college team, the Malone Pioneers, lost 5-0 in their NCAA Division II baseball game against the Cedarville Yellow Jackets.

The game took place at Thurman Munson Memorial Stadium. This was their third matchup against the Yellow Jackets this season.
